Ledger Live — Secure Cryptocurrency Management

Ledger Live is the official software companion for Ledger hardware wallets, designed to give users a secure, clear, and convenient way to manage digital assets. It brings together portfolio tracking, account management, transaction creation, staking, and device maintenance in a single interface while ensuring that private keys remain safely stored inside the hardware wallet. This separation of duties—software for convenience, hardware for security—helps reduce attack surface and makes managing cryptocurrencies accessible to both beginners and experienced users.

Core purpose and philosophy

The core idea behind Ledger Live is simple: provide a modern, usable interface that never compromises the strongest available security. Ledger Live prepares transactions, displays balances and market data, and communicates with blockchains, but the act of signing any sensitive operation happens inside the Ledger device. By requiring physical confirmation on the device for every important action, Ledger Live minimizes the risk that malware, phishing, or compromised hosts can steal funds.

How it works

Ledger Live runs on desktop and mobile platforms and connects to a Ledger hardware wallet via USB or Bluetooth. When you create a transaction, the app constructs the unsigned transaction and sends it to the hardware device. The device independently displays the transaction details and asks the user to approve or reject. Only after approval does the device sign the transaction and send the signed payload back to Ledger Live for broadcast. This two-step model prevents attackers from secretly altering transaction parameters.

Getting started

Getting started typically involves installing Ledger Live on your computer or phone, connecting your Ledger hardware wallet, and following the guided setup. During initialization you will configure a device PIN and securely generate a recovery seed. The app assists with adding cryptocurrency accounts and installing required applications on the device. Users can choose a basic workflow for immediate use or explore advanced options like passphrases and hidden wallets for additional privacy.

Security best practices

Ledger Live is secure by design, but users still must follow best practices. Never enter or store your recovery seed on a computer or phone. Keep firmware and the Ledger Live application updated. Always verify transaction details shown on the hardware device before approving. Use a strong PIN and consider enabling an additional passphrase to create hidden wallets when higher privacy is required. Storing backup copies of recovery material in multiple safe, offline locations reduces the risk of loss.

Troubleshooting and support

Common issues are usually resolved by checking cables and connections, restarting the app or device, or updating software and firmware. If accounts do not display properly, resyncing or rescanning in Ledger Live often fixes discrepancies. Built-in diagnostics and help sections guide users through routine problems. For more complex situations, official support channels and community resources can provide step-by-step assistance while advising on safe recovery and restoration procedures.
